-extern uint64_t __thread_selfusage(void);
-
-#define timeval2nsec(tv) (tv.tv_sec * NSEC_PER_SEC + tv.tv_usec * NSEC_PER_USEC)
-
-static uint64_t
-_boottime_fallback_usec(void)
-{
-    struct timeval tv;
-    size_t len = sizeof(tv);
-    int ret = sysctlbyname("kern.boottime", &tv, &len, NULL, 0);
-    if (ret == -1) return 0;
-    return (uint64_t)tv.tv_sec * USEC_PER_SEC + (uint64_t)tv.tv_usec;
-}
-
-static int
-_mach_boottime_usec(uint64_t *boottime, struct timeval *realtime)
-{
-    uint64_t bt1 = 0, bt2 = 0;
-    int ret;
-    do {
-        bt1 = mach_boottime_usec();
-        if (os_slowpath(bt1 == 0)) bt1 = _boottime_fallback_usec();
-
-        atomic_thread_fence(memory_order_seq_cst);
-
-        ret = gettimeofday(realtime, NULL);
-        if (ret != 0) return ret;
-
-        atomic_thread_fence(memory_order_seq_cst);
-
-        bt2 = mach_boottime_usec();
-        if (os_slowpath(bt2 == 0)) bt2 = _boottime_fallback_usec();
-    } while (os_slowpath(bt1 != bt2));
-    *boottime = bt1;
-    return 0;
-}
-
-uint64_t
-clock_gettime_nsec_np(clockid_t clock_id)
-{
-    switch(clock_id){
-    case CLOCK_REALTIME: {
-        struct timeval tv;
-        int ret = gettimeofday(&tv, NULL);
-        if (ret) return 0;
-        return timeval2nsec(tv);
-    }
-    case CLOCK_MONOTONIC: {
-        struct timeval tv;
-        uint64_t boottime;
-        int ret = _mach_boottime_usec(&boottime, &tv);
-        if (ret) return 0;
-        boottime *= NSEC_PER_USEC;
-        return timeval2nsec(tv) - boottime;
-    }
-    case CLOCK_PROCESS_CPUTIME_ID: {
-        struct rusage ru;
-        int ret = getrusage(RUSAGE_SELF, &ru);
-        if (ret) return 0;
-        return timeval2nsec(ru.ru_utime) + timeval2nsec(ru.ru_stime);
-    }
-    default:
-        // calls that use mach_absolute_time units fall through into a common path
-        break;
-    }
-
-    // Mach Absolute Time unit-based calls
-    mach_timebase_info_data_t tb_info;
-    kern_return_t kr = mach_timebase_info(&tb_info);
-    if (kr != KERN_SUCCESS) {
-        errno = EINVAL;
-        return 0;
-    }
-    uint64_t mach_time;
-
-    switch(clock_id){
-    case CLOCK_MONOTONIC_RAW:
-        mach_time = mach_continuous_time();
-        break;
-    case CLOCK_MONOTONIC_RAW_APPROX:
-        mach_time = mach_continuous_approximate_time();
-        break;
-    case CLOCK_UPTIME_RAW:
-        mach_time = mach_absolute_time();
-        break;
-    case CLOCK_UPTIME_RAW_APPROX:
-        mach_time = mach_approximate_time();
-        break;
-    case CLOCK_THREAD_CPUTIME_ID:
-        mach_time = __thread_selfusage();
-        break;
-    default:
-        errno = EINVAL;
-        return 0;
-    }
-
-    return (mach_time * tb_info.numer) / tb_info.denom;
-}

-int
-clock_gettime(clockid_t clk_id, struct timespec *tp)
-{
-    switch(clk_id){
-    case CLOCK_REALTIME: {
-        struct timeval tv;
-        int ret = gettimeofday(&tv, NULL);
-        TIMEVAL_TO_TIMESPEC(&tv, tp);
-        return ret;
-    }
-    case CLOCK_MONOTONIC: {
-        struct timeval tv;
-        uint64_t boottime_usec;
-        int ret = _mach_boottime_usec(&boottime_usec, &tv);
-        struct timeval boottime = {
-            .tv_sec = boottime_usec / USEC_PER_SEC,
-            .tv_usec = boottime_usec % USEC_PER_SEC
-        };
-        timersub(&tv, &boottime, &tv);
-        TIMEVAL_TO_TIMESPEC(&tv, tp);
-        return ret;
-    }
-    case CLOCK_PROCESS_CPUTIME_ID: {
-        struct rusage ru;
-        int ret = getrusage(RUSAGE_SELF, &ru);
-        timeradd(&ru.ru_utime, &ru.ru_stime, &ru.ru_utime);
-        TIMEVAL_TO_TIMESPEC(&ru.ru_utime, tp);
-        return ret;
-    }
-    case CLOCK_MONOTONIC_RAW:
-    case CLOCK_MONOTONIC_RAW_APPROX:
-    case CLOCK_UPTIME_RAW:
-    case CLOCK_UPTIME_RAW_APPROX:
-    case CLOCK_THREAD_CPUTIME_ID: {
-        uint64_t ns = clock_gettime_nsec_np(clk_id);
-        if (!ns) return -1;
-
-        tp->tv_sec = ns/NSEC_PER_SEC;
-        tp->tv_nsec = ns % NSEC_PER_SEC;
-        return 0;
-    }
-    default:
-        errno = EINVAL;
-        return -1;
-    }
-}
-
-int
-clock_getres(clockid_t clk_id, struct timespec *res)
-{
-    switch(clk_id){
-    case CLOCK_REALTIME:
-    case CLOCK_MONOTONIC:
-    case CLOCK_PROCESS_CPUTIME_ID:
-        res->tv_nsec = NSEC_PER_USEC;
-        res->tv_sec = 0;
-        return 0;
-
-    case CLOCK_MONOTONIC_RAW:
-    case CLOCK_MONOTONIC_RAW_APPROX:
-    case CLOCK_UPTIME_RAW:
-    case CLOCK_UPTIME_RAW_APPROX:
-    case CLOCK_THREAD_CPUTIME_ID: {
-        mach_timebase_info_data_t tb_info;
-        kern_return_t kr = mach_timebase_info(&tb_info);
-        if (kr != KERN_SUCCESS) {
-            errno = EINVAL;
-            return -1;
-        }
-        res->tv_nsec = tb_info.numer / tb_info.denom + (tb_info.numer % tb_info.denom != 0);
-        res->tv_sec = 0;
-        return 0;
-    }
-
-    default:
-        errno = EINVAL;
-        return -1;
-    }
-}
-
-int
-clock_settime(clockid_t clk_id, const struct timespec *tp)
-{
-    switch(clk_id){
-    case CLOCK_REALTIME: {
-        struct timeval tv = {
-            .tv_sec = (time_t)tp->tv_sec,
-            .tv_usec = (suseconds_t)(tp->tv_nsec / (suseconds_t)NSEC_PER_USEC)
-        };
-        return settimeofday(&tv, NULL);
-    }
-    default:
-        errno = EINVAL;
-        return -1;
-    }
-}
